About the role

Responsibilities

  • Lead end-to-end operational readiness and Government Soft Landings programmes to ensure assets are safe and compliant at handover
  • Provide strategic oversight across multiple projects and act as a trusted advisor to senior stakeholders
  • Develop comprehensive Operational Readiness Plans including governance, KPIs, and risk management
  • Act as the key interface between project, engineering, construction, and operations teams
  • Lead FM mobilisation, including service partner procurement, onboarding, and performance frameworks
  • Oversee asset information handover and ensure integration into CAFM/IWMS systems
  • Ensure full statutory and regulatory compliance, including fire and life safety
  • Drive growth of the Operational Readiness service line through business development and bid leadership
  • Line manage and develop consultants to build capability in FM advisory
  • Manage project financials and maintain oversight of risk and quality assurance

Requirements

  • Extensive experience delivering FM Operational Readiness or mobilisation programmes
  • Strong understanding of asset handover, commissioning, and transition into operations
  • Expertise in CAFM / IWMS systems and asset data management
  • Deep knowledge of FM operations, compliance, and maintenance strategies (e.g., SFG20)
  • Proven ability to lead design reviews and readiness assurance activities
  • Strong stakeholder engagement and influence skills at senior levels
  • Degree qualified in a relevant discipline
  • Professional accreditation such as IWFM, RICS, or CIBSE is desirable
  • Proven leadership experience within FM advisory or consultancy
  • Proficiency in Microsoft Office suite
